Arrival Day Information
Please note that this information applies to first-year and transfer students arriving on Monday 8/24 or Thursday 8/27. If your arrival date is different, please touch base with your program lead for information on your move-in procedures.
Here’s what to expect:
Arriving with Loved Ones
1. Arrive at Commons between 8:00am and noon
- Located at 136 Central Ave., Lewiston, ME 04240. Don’t park the car and head there on foot – show up in your car!
- An energetic welcome team will be there to welcome you to Bates!
- Students will be dropped off to head into Commons.
- Loved ones (whoever’s driving the car!) will proceed to their student’s residence.
2. Students: Get your Bates ID and room key
- Check in inside Commons – they’ll ask you a few questions, and when all is said and done, you’ll get your Bates ID, and (if applicable) your room key.
- After checking in, exit Commons on the other side and head to your residence.
- NOTE: If you haven’t completed all of your New Student Forms, you will be asked to step aside to do so before getting your Bates ID and room key.
3. Loved Ones: Arrive at your student’s residence
- Pull up to your student’s residence – you’ll see signs denoting unloading zones. A Bates volunteer will greet you.
- You’ll be asked who’s being moved in, and they will confirm the room number.
- You’ll be handed an index card with your student’s room number on it, which you’ll be asked to display on your dashboard so our team of student movers know where everything’s going.
- Sit back and let our moving team do the work for you! Many find that their car is unpacked before their student arrives from Commons.
- Once the car is unloaded, proceed to a parking area. Volunteers can direct you to the nearest one to the residence.
4. Students: Arrive at your residence
- Head to the unloading zone signs at your residence, to see if the car is still being unloaded.
- If not, head inside to your room to rejoin your loved ones, and meet your ResLife student staff and roommate.
- Note that if you are arriving on Monday 8/24, you may not meet your student staff until later that day, and your roommate may not be arriving until Thursday.
- Start unpacking!

Arriving Independently
1. Arrive at Commons between 8:00am and noon
- Located at 136 Central Ave., Lewiston, ME 04240.
- If you drove, it’s OK to temporarily park on the street outside Commons – follow the directions of the welcome team. Drive to your residence after picking up your Bates ID and room key.
- If you’re just getting dropped off (e.g., via taxi or rideshare) you’re welcome to bring your luggage into Commons with you.
- An energetic welcome team will be there to welcome you to Bates, and direct you into Commons.
2. Get your Bates ID and room key
- Check in inside Commons – they’ll ask you a few questions, and when all is said and done, you’ll get your Bates ID, and (if applicable) your room key.
- After checking in, exit Commons and head to your residence.
- NOTE: If you haven’t completed all of your New Student Forms, you will be asked to step aside to do so before getting your Bates ID and room key.
3. Arriving at your residence
- With a car:
- Pull up to your residence – you’ll see signs denoting unloading zones. A Bates volunteer will greet you.
- You’ll be asked your name, and they will confirm the room number.
- You’ll be handed an index card with your room number on it, which you’ll be asked to display on your dashboard so our team of movers know where everything’s going.
- Sit back and let our moving team do the work for you!
- Once the car is unloaded, proceed to a parking area. Volunteers can direct you to the nearest one to the residence, or to permanent student parking.
- Head back to your residence, and start unpacking!
- Without a car:
- Check in with a Bates volunteer outside the residence – they will verify your room number with you.
- Head inside to your room to meet your ResLife student staff and roommate.
- Note that if you are arriving on Monday 8/24, you may not meet your student staff until later that day, and your roommate may not be arriving until Thursday.
- Start unpacking!
